Mt Jewett Elementary School (Closed 2009)

Po Box 7267
Mount Jewett, PA 16740
(School attendance zone shown in map)
Mt Jewett Elementary School serves 65 students in grades 1-5. 
Minority enrollment was 3%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which was lower than the Pennsylvania state average of 39% (majority Hispanic).
